RM13 8LU lies on Philip Road in Rainham. RM13 8LU is located in the South Hornchurch electoral ward, within the London borough of Havering and the English Parliamentary constituency of Dagenham and Rainham.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S North East London ICB - A3A8R and the police force is Metropolitan Police.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
